The combined Boards of Olney Theatre Center for the Arts and Olney Theatre Corporation, led by President Jennifer Kneeland, are pleased to announce the appointment of Deborah Ellinghaus as Managing Director, beginning August 26, 2014.

Ms. Ellinghaus comes to Olney Theatre Center from the University of Maryland, College Park, where she served as Director of Development for the College of Arts and Humanities since 2011. Prior to her tenure at Maryland, she spent six years as Senior Associate Director of Development and Alumni Affairs at Yale School of Drama/Yale Repertory Theatre in New Haven, CT. At Yale, she was part of a university-wide campaign that raised more than $3.8 billion and included transformational gifts for Yale Rep from the Andrew W. Mellon Foundation and the Robina Foundation, which established the Binger Center for New Theatre. Previously, Ms. Ellinghaus was the Director of Development at off-Broadway's Jean Cocteau Repertory Theatre. She currently chairs the Downtown Arts and Culture Commission in Columbia, Maryland, and sits on the boards of the Inner Arbor Trust and the Howard County Board of Health. A native of Columbia, MD, she lives in Fulton with her husband and two children.

Ms. Ellinghaus succeeds Amy Marshall, who ended her tenure earlier this summer.

About Olney Theatre Center
Olney Theatre Center, celebrating its 76th Anniversary in 2014, is an award-winning, nonprofit, Equity theatre. Located just north of Washington, D.C. in arts-rich Montgomery County, Maryland, Olney Theatre Center offers a diverse array of professional productions year-round. OlneyTheatre Center is situated on 14 acres in the heart of the beautiful Washington-Baltimore-Frederick "triangle," within easy access of all three cities.
